This project will provide new tissues for the expanding field of regenerative medicine to treat numerous tissue defects and
1.Benefit the health & economic well being of Australian society by rapidly supplying organs and tissues.
2.Benefit the academic community by a multidisciplinary approach, involving several academic Institutions in the fields of surgery, tissue engineering, physiology, morphology, polymer chemistry & biomolecular engineering that will produce basic scientific data with a practical application. Post-graduate students and staff will train & gain significant knowledge in this area.
3. Benefit industry through new product development and IP. This project advances a platform technology with multiple applications.Read moreRead less
Three dimensional (3D) optical coherence tomography in cancer. This project will establish for the first time how well 3D optical coherence tomography, a form of medical imaging, can image cancer. Based on this, a version built into a needle will be developed which will enable extension much deeper into tissues than previously possible to image cancer and to guide related surgical procedures.
